集成接口
便捷且兼容性极强的专业领域解决方案

API集成接口解决方案的优势

适用特殊行业商户

大幅降低商户接入成本

使用API接口解决方案,系统商可直接调
用接口文档,无需开发,为商户节省大量开发
成本,降低对接难度。

无需切换系统即可完成移动支付收款

API接口解决方案,可以让商户在原有系统中
完成收款,商户、顾客交易方式基本没有改变。

原系统对接、安全可靠

原有系统对接,无需安装第三方插件,资金安全
有保障,双系统对账(微信支付、支付宝官方平
台和商户原有系统),账单准确,可随时查账。

大幅降低商户对接时间

原系统供应商可在短时间内调用API接口并
完成系统配置。商户可快速接入移动支付,并
且不影响原有系统功能应用,帮商户节省大量
接入开发时间。

哪些商户需要使用API解决方案?

创匠科技,为商户提供安全稳定的接口API解决方案,成本低,对接难度小。商户使用原系统即可实现
移动支付收款,无需改变使用习惯,用户体验感更好。

医院

药店

连锁便利店

汽车站

收费站

大型医院、大型超市、大型连锁便利店、连锁品牌快餐、汽车站、收费站等行业,有行业定制化的
专业系统,但无法安装插件,且对收银的时效要求极高。若商户想接入移动支付,并且直接对接原系统供应商,
可能会碰到开发成本高,对接难度大等问题。这些行业急需使用API解决方案。

接口调用逻辑举例说明

API接口解决方案,安全、稳定
终端
Server
二维码
提交预生产订单
返回支付url
订单状态有误,刷新订单
返回订单信息
支付成功,回调订单状态信息
根据支付url
生成支付二维码
支付请求

接口调用逻辑举例说明

为收银系统集成支付API提供调用支付接口,用户通过多种方式调起支付模块完成支付。
将创匠科技收银系统接入商户原有系统,所有操作均在商户系统完成。

请求参数说明

参数(例:)

参数名称

类型

是否必须

示例值

描述

appid

appid

Varchar(32)

必须

Asd132sadf561ads123sadf

每个商户自己的appid

sign

签名

Varchar(32)

必须

288100720801151687safd

根据appsecret进行签名

total_amount

支付金额

int

必须

12912

支付金额,单位:分,该支付金额是实际金额。

discountable_amount

优惠金额

int

非必

888

优惠金额,单位:分

discount_coupon

优惠券

Varchar(32)

非必

13004567132648

微信支付优惠券

body

商品名称

Varchar(32)

必须

ipad pro

商品名称

detail

商品详情

Varchar(8192)

必须

ipad pro

说明详见商品明细说明

auth_code

用户授权码

Varchar(128)

必须

130025998499

支付用户授权码,扫码获得

attach

附加数据

Varchar(128)

非必须

说明

附加数据,在查询API和支付回调通知中原样
返回,该字段主要携带订单的自定义数据;如
果有门店信息,请添加到此字段中

pay_type

支付方式

Varchar(2)

非必须

1

0:微信
1:支付宝
如果不传即自动识别

nonce_str

随机数

Varchar(32)

必须

1321325649879465123

随机32位数

out_trade_no

商户订单号

Varchar(32)

必须

132134651234613

商户订单号,订单号必须唯一,长度8-32位

数据返回说明

名称

参数名称

类型

是否必须

示例值

描述

code

状态码

Varchar(16)

必须

0

具体返回值如下:
1、0(成功) 2、100(系统错误)
3、200(未被授权)4、201(签名不正确)
5、202(功能未开通)6、300(参数有误)
7、301(其它错误)8、302(支付异常)
9、303(请求超时,请同步订单)10、304(用户授权码不能为空)
11、305(支付方式有误)12、306(支付金额不能为0)
13、311(APPID有误)当code为0时返回其他信息

trade_state

交易状态

Varchar(16)

必须

0

具体返回值如下
1、0:未支付 2、1:支付成功3、2:支付失败 4、3:已退款
5、4:已撤销 6、5:部分退款 7、6:已关闭

trade_id

创匠系统订
单号

Varchar(32)

必须

132132132

创匠系统订单号

err_msg

错误提示

Varchar(50)

非必须

签名不正确

错误提示

pay_time

支付时间

Varchar(20)

非必须

2016-06-20 20:30:15

支付时间

API接口对接流程

在商户平台创建开放应用
并审核通过获取开放接口

商户给系统供应商
提供接口文档

系统供应商调用支付接口
进行集成,商户即可快速
实现移动支付收银功能

适用场景

适用行业

接口API解决方案适合:

  • 有收银系统;

  • 收银系统无法安装插件;

  • 有特殊的网络适用规范及要求;

商户接入后,无需切换系统即可完成移动支付收款,配合匠小盒,更可实现更流畅、更快捷的移动支付交易体验。

推介商户:

大型医院、连锁药店、中大型超市、连锁便利店、汽车站、收费站等。

注:不是所有的商户都需要集成。
商户对接前,可咨询我们,咨询适用行业,我们会为您提供更适合您实际使用需求的专业解决方案。